Dean D. Tidd, age 93, passed away peacefully on Feb. 7, 2011, at Attleboro Nursing & Rehabilitation. Born and raised in Roundhead, OH, on his family’s farm in Hardin Co., (where it’s been a homestead farm and is now a biological research station for Ohio Northern University which was willed by his family to them) he moved here to the newly formed area in 1952 to work and raise his family. He was a retiree of U.S. Steel Co. where he worked for 30 years in the Locomotive & Car Shop. He was a U.S. Army Veteran who always served in Special Orders beginning with the Calvary, was involved in the Pacific theatre, and finished with the Corp. of Engineers. He was an avid reader, history buff, enjoyed playing golf, and was passionate about family genealogy. He had a strong sense of integrity, was mechanically inclined, constantly repairing and fixing things, and was the greatest story-teller. He was a very caring, loving, strong-willed husband, father, grandfather, great grandfather, and friend. He was preceded in death by his parents Hollister & Myrtle Tidd; his brother Paul; and 3 sisters Helen, Margaret, and Wanda. He will be sadly missed by his wife of 68 years Florence (nee: Hines). He is the devoted father of Randy Tidd and his wife Kevin and Denise McIntire and her husband Pat; and the loving grandfather of Bryan, Eric, Kathryn, and Ceilidh; and great grandfather of Joshua. He is also survived by nieces, nephews, and cousins.
